Oregon Code § ORS 343.565

Definitions for ORS 343.565 to 343.595
Open in Lexace · Ask the AI about this section
As used in ORS 343.565 to 343.595:
(1) Braille means the system of reading and writing through touch commonly known as standard English Braille.
(2) Student who is blind means an individual who:
(a) Is eligible for special education due to visual impairment; or
(b) Has a medically indicated expectation of visual deterioration.
